Understanding Hydraulic Hose Adapters: Types And Uses

Hydraulic hose adapters are essential components in hydraulic systems, serving various purposes that enhance the functionality and performance of the overall design. They enable the connection of different hose types, sizes, and materials, ensuring that the hydraulic fluid can flow effectively through the system. Let’s explore the various types of hydraulic hose adapters and their specific uses.

Types of Hydraulic Hose Adapters

  • Straight Adapters: These are the most common type of hydraulic hose adapters, allowing for a direct connection between two hoses. They maintain a straight alignment, which is ideal for applications with limited space.
  • Elbow Adapters: Elbow adapters come in varying angles, typically 45 or 90 degrees, facilitating directional changes in hydraulic hose paths. This type is particularly useful in tight spaces where hoses cannot be routed in a straight line.
  • Reducer Adapters: These adapters are designed to connect hoses of different diameters. They help in transitioning from a larger diameter hose to a smaller one, ensuring compatibility in various sections of a hydraulic system.
  • Couplings: Couplings are connectors that allow for quick disconnection and reconnection of hydraulic hoses. They are often used in applications where hoses need to be changed frequently or need to be easily maintained.
  • Threaded Adapters: These are used to connect hoses to threaded ports or fittings, allowing for secure and leak-proof connections. They come in various thread types and sizes to cater to numerous hydraulic systems.

Uses of Hydraulic Hose Adapters

Hydraulic hose adapters serve diverse applications across multiple industries, including:

  • Agriculture: Used in tractors and farming equipment to facilitate the movement of hydraulic fluids for various tasks such as lifting and steering.
  • Construction: Essential in heavy machinery like excavators and bulldozers, ensuring reliable hydraulic fluid connections for equipment operation.
  • Automotive: Commonly found in hydraulic braking systems and power steering systems, ensuring efficient operation and performance.
  • Manufacturing: Used in hydraulic presses and assembly lines to manage fluid power and enhance operational efficiency.

How To Choose The Right Hydraulic Hose Adapter For Your Needs

Choosing the right hydraulic hose adapter is crucial for ensuring the efficiency and safety of your hydraulic systems. Here are some key factors to consider:

  • Compatibility: Ensure the adapter is compatible with both your hydraulic hose and the equipment it connects to. Check the thread type and size for a proper fit.
  • Material: Select an adapter made from durable materials such as steel or brass, which can withstand high pressure and resist corrosion. The material should also be suitable for the fluid being used.
  • Pressure Rating: Verify that the adapter can handle the pressure rating of your hydraulic system to prevent leaks or failures.
  • Temperature Range: Ensure the adapter can operate within the temperature range of your system to maintain performance and longevity.
  • Type of Connection: Identify whether you need a permanent connection (crimped fittings) or a removable one (threaded fittings or quick couplers) based on your application requirements.
  • Service Environment: Consider the environmental conditions where the hydraulic hose will operate. Adaptors may need specific features to endure extreme temperatures, exposure to chemicals, or other challenging conditions.
  • Regulatory Standards: Check if the adapter meets the necessary industry standards and regulations, which can influence performance and safety.

    Common Issues With Hydraulic Hose Adapters And Their Solutions

    Hydraulic hose adapters play a crucial role in the functionality and efficiency of hydraulic systems. However, they are not immune to various issues that can arise during operation. Here are some common problems associated with hydraulic hose adapters and their potential solutions:

    Issue Description Solution
    Leaking Connections Leakage can occur due to improper installation, wear, or damage to the threads. Ensure that connections are tightened properly and inspect seals for wear. Replace damaged components as necessary.
    Corrosion Corrosive environments can lead to deterioration of metal adapters. Use corrosion-resistant materials and regularly inspect adapters for signs of rust. Replace as needed.
    Compatibility Issues Using an adapter that does not fit correctly can result in leaks and system failure. Always verify the size, thread type, and pressure ratings of both the hose and the adapter before installation.
    Flexibility Limitations Some adapters may not allow for the necessary flexibility in hydraulic lines, leading to increased strain. Select adapters designed for flexibility, and consider using additional fittings to accommodate movement.
    Over-tightening Applying excessive torque can damage threads and cause leaks. Utilize a torque wrench to apply the manufacturer’s recommended torque specifications.

    By being aware of these common issues and their solutions, you can ensure that your hydraulic hose adapters function effectively and maintain the integrity of your hydraulic systems.     Frequently Asked Questions

    What are hydraulic hose adapters?

    Hydraulic hose adapters are fittings used to connect hoses to pipes or other equipment in hydraulic systems, enabling the transfer of hydraulic fluid.

    Why are hydraulic hose adapters important?

    They are crucial for ensuring a secure and leak-proof connection between different components in a hydraulic system, which helps maintain system efficiency and safety.

    What materials are hydraulic hose adapters made from?

    Hydraulic hose adapters are typically made from materials such as steel, stainless steel, aluminum, brass, or plastic, depending on the application’s requirements for strength and corrosion resistance.

    How do I choose the right hydraulic hose adapter?

    Choosing the right adapter involves considering factors like the hose and fitting sizes, thread type, material compatibility, and the specific demands of the hydraulic application.

    Can hydraulic hose adapters be reused?

    While some hydraulic hose adapters can be reused, it is essential to inspect them for damage or wear. If they show signs of deterioration, they should be replaced to avoid leaks or failures.

    What are some common types of hydraulic hose adapters?

    Common types include straight adapters, elbow adapters, tee adapters, and swivel adapters, each serving different connection angles and configurations.

    What are the safety considerations when using hydraulic hose adapters?

    Safety considerations include ensuring proper torque when fastening connections, regularly inspecting for leaks or wear, and using the correct size and type of adapter for the specific hydraulic system.
